In attempting to slipstream SP2 into an original copy of Office 2003, I
have encountered an error. Main2spff.msp can be handled properly, but
the next file, OWC11sp2.msp fails and results in an an error message
"This installation package could not be opened. Verify that the package
exists and that you can access it, or contact the application vendor to
verify that this is a valid Windows Installer package."
Whereby the SP2 files have been extracted to d:\office_sp2, and the
Office CD files have been installed to d:\Office,
msiexec /p D:\Office_SP2\OWC11SP2ff.msp /a D:\Office\OWC11.MSI
shortfilenames=true /qb
results in the above error. Anyone have an idea where the glitch is? The
OWC file is indeed there and can be executed. Using WXPsp2 if it matters.
